Blight release US team
Blight Gaming have confirmed they have decided to release their Counter-Strike squad hailing from the United States.
The American team had recently made headlines when they announced that Kevin "aZn" Wang and Fadil "Nepo" Canovic had been brought in for the local WCG qualifier.
However, Blight have now announced the dismissal of the entire division due to their lack of stability and the fact that one more of their regular players would not be able to attend the WCG qualifier.
"We will be releasing our USA team due to the fact they have been unable to maintain a starting five as well as due to their lack of practice," Blight owner James "blackfoger" Larsen told GotFrag.com. Additionally, Dustin "dizzaman" Dilyerd would have been unable to attend WCG USA due to school.
Blight Gaming plan to announce a new American Counter-Strike team, which should happen within the space of a month.
Blight had the following team:
Dustin "dizzaman" Dilyerd
Chris "truls" Navratil
Dan "mehLer" Mehler
David "Xp3" Garrido
Kevin "aZn" Wang (WCG stand-in)
Fadil "Nepo" Canovic (WCG stand-in)
